Protective floor matting can make a big difference in areas where comfort, grip, impact protection and floor preservation are important. Whether the space is a stable, workshop, gym, garage, warehouse, transport vehicle or general working area, the right mat can help protect the floor while making the surface safer and more practical to use.

Two similar but very different floor protection options available from Mats4U are the EVA Foam Puzzled Edged Linkable Stable Mats and Ribbed Rubber Roll Matting. Both can protect floors, improve comfort and provide a more usable surface, but they are designed for different applications.

EVA Foam Stable Mats are thicker, lighter and more cushioned, making them ideal for stables, livestock housing, animal transport, gym areas and impact protection. Ribbed Rubber Roll Matting is thinner, more flexible and supplied in rolls, making it better for workshops, garages, warehouses, vehicle flooring, commercial kitchens and general anti-slip floor protection.

Quick Comparison: EVA Foam Stable Mats vs Ribbed Rubber Roll Matting

The table below gives a simple overview of how the two mats compare.

Feature EVA Foam Stable Mats Ribbed Rubber Roll Matting
Best For Stables, animal housing, transport vehicles, gyms and cushioned areas Workshops, garages, warehouses, vehicle flooring and general anti-slip protection
Material Expanded EVA foam High-quality rubber
Format Interlocking puzzle tiles Roll matting and cut lengths
Thickness 24mm 3mm or 6mm
Main Benefit Cushioning, shock absorption and insulation Traction, dirt trapping and floor protection
Installation Loose lay and connect using puzzle edges Roll out and cut to size
Main Advantage Thicker cushioned protection Flexible roll coverage for many areas

Material and Construction Comparison

The material difference is one of the most important factors when choosing between these two mats. EVA foam and rubber behave differently, so the best option depends on whether you need cushioning or hard-wearing surface protection.

EVA Foam Stable Mat Material

EVA Foam Stable Mats are made from dense expanded EVA foam. This material is lightweight, cushioned and insulating, making it ideal for comfort and shock absorption.

Ribbed Rubber Roll Matting Material

Ribbed Rubber Roll Matting is made from high-quality rubber. Rubber is stronger for general floor protection, grip, chemical resistance and long-term use in workshops, garages and industrial environments.

Which Material Is Softer?

EVA foam is the softer and more cushioned material. It is better where animals, people or equipment need a padded surface.

Which Material Is Better for Tough Floor Protection?

Rubber is better for tough floor protection. Ribbed Rubber Roll Matting is designed to protect floors in areas where grip, durability and resistance to oils, grease and chemicals are important.

Cleaning and Maintenance Comparison

Cleaning is important for both mats because dirt, dust, moisture and debris can build up on the surface over time.

Cleaning EVA Foam Stable Mats

EVA Foam Stable Mats should be swept or vacuumed regularly. They can also be cleaned with warm water and a mild detergent, then rinsed and left to air dry. Harsh chemicals and solvent-based cleaners should be avoided.

Cleaning Ribbed Rubber Roll Matting

Ribbed Rubber Roll Matting can be swept or vacuumed daily. For spot cleaning, use a damp cloth with mild detergent. For deeper cleaning, it can be mopped with a rubber-safe cleaning solution or hosed down outdoors and allowed to air dry.

Which Is Easier to Clean?

Both are easy to clean. Ribbed Rubber Roll Matting may be more practical for messy industrial areas because it can be hosed down and used in areas exposed to oils, grease and chemicals.

Maintenance Tip

For both products, keep the floor underneath clean and dry where possible. Dirt trapped beneath matting can affect stability and long-term performance.
